Hey folks. Just purchased a 2017 MX5200 ... had it delivered yesterday. Has only 1.5hrs on it. Now, I have operated heavy equipment my entire life growing up in a construction family but this is my first smaller tractor. I have a box blade on the rear end with the additional top and tilt kit to make it more useful. I also added a 4 in 1 front bucket so I have the third function hydro buttons on the stick. Here is the issue .... after the truck left and I got on it to try it out I quickly found what I consider a major issue. The box (3pt hitch) will not raise at all unless I rev the engine up past 3000 rpm and even then it comes up very very very slowly .... this cannot be right. This would render it impossible to make the fine tuning adjustments as you make a grading pass for leveling a building pad area etc ... Something must be wrong with the hydro system. I am having a similar issue with the 4 in 1 bucket .. it won't open/close until about 3000rpm and operates slowly. All the other hydraulics work just fine at lower rpms ..... any ideas from the more experienced Kubota owners here? This tractor is brand new:mad:

Wonder if they botched the 3rd function install?

Typically the 3pt has first dibs on hydro flow, sounds like a hose is plugged, bucking flow, purging pressure or somehow the 3pt system is wonky???
